there was one article about this movie that couldn't quite handle nor understand Rick's hatred for hippies since hippies are, after all, the mentors of all journalists etc

the thing is, the hippie kids turned off a lot of actors and made once-liberals (who were different in a different era) into what James Cagney called himself post-sixties an arch conservative: also included on that list is a guy named Ronald Reagan)…

that said, if you look at the actors who Rick was based on, it was guys like Steve McQueen and Clint Eastwood (had they not gotten big following their Western TV roles) and Ty Hardin, who were all somewhat on the conservative level back then and even more-so later, and he was (RICK that is) not a fan of hippies, or how the culture had shaped into hippies…

the irony of the Manson Family is only later would they be separated from the hippie counter-culture given their violence… before that, they were simply hippies who had the same political beliefs as the "pigs" (who were rich, and hippies hated rich folk): including the fact they were all environmentalists; in fact, Manson STILL has a "GREEN" website, alive and kicking online…

but what I think is part of Leo's brilliance in this movie is that it was in fact a performance: his Rick Dalton is NOTHING like Rick Dalton…

There's a plot hole in this movie that always bothered me. It's easy for viewers to miss this because we have context.

Leonardo Dicaprio witnesses a woman break through the glass of his patio door, screaming in pain, covered in blood, appearing to be blinded, who then falls in a pool.

He has no context of who she is. He did not see the burglary nor does he know what just took place with Brad Pitt.

From Leo's vantage point, she could have been a victim of someone else herself, and was trying to escape the house.

So what's Leo do? He grabs a flamethrower and burns her alive to death.

There was not even a clear indication (from Leo's POV) that she was intending to attack Leo with the weapon, because she shot upward, but even so, it would've been understood in her condition, if she was just assaulted, let alone blinded.

Tarantino forget to write that a clear indication for Leo that this girl is a villain.
